On today's episode I'll be exploring what trauma truly means and how it is far more common than many realize. In fact, most exhausting habituated patterns can be traced back to trauma and those easy-to-discount experiences are, in fact, actually traumas. Allow me to help you recognize these traumas so you can name them and then begin to address them.
Listen in as I discuss the difference between big-T and little-t trauma, including a whole host of examples for each. I'll also be sharing the ways these types of trauma impact you, physically and psychologically. Lastly, I'll offer a two-step practice to help guide you in grounding your nervous system when such feelings arise.
